PCB assembly is where the bare board ends up being a useful electronic circuit card. In a typical SMT process, solder paste is used with a stencil circuit board, components are positioned with automatic makers, and the assembly is reflow soldered. For double sided PCB or multi-layer board constructs, this can occur on both sides of the board. Through-hole parts and specialized components are then placed and soldered, in some cases by wave soldering or discerning soldering. The quality of pcb assembly depends on positioning accuracy, solder quality, evaluation, and rework control. Design features such as fiducials, vias, and stackup choices are necessary to effective manufacturing. Fiducials meaning in electronics describes reference marks used by machines to align components properly during assembly. Fiducials on pcb layouts enhance positioning precision, specifically for fine-pitch parts and BGA assembly. Likewise, recognizing what is a via and how pcb vias work is basic to multilayer design. Conventional vias link layers, blind via openings link an external layer to an inner layer, and buried vias attach internal layers without getting to the surface. For dense designs, microvia and stacked microvias are used in high density interconnect pcb and hdi printed circuit card develops. Techniques such as via in pad, pad in via, backdrill, and blind and buried vias are frequently applied in advanced pcb fabrication and assembly to lower signal loss and preserve routing room.

There are several types of circuit boards, each matched to a certain application. Rigid printed motherboard are the most typical, yet flexible circuitry, flexible circuit boards, flex printed circuit, and flexible printed circuit card are progressively used in wearable gadgets, cameras, vehicle components, and medical systems. Rigid-flex printed circuit board products combine both structures right into one assembly, boosting and lowering connectors reliability. Because they assist with warm dissipation, Aluminum pcb board and metal core printed circuit board layouts are used for LED and power electronics. Heavy copper pcb and thick copper pcb variants are selected for power distribution, electric motor control, and industrial PCB manufacturing applications. For demanding environments such as aerospace pcb assembly or aerospace printed circuit card, manufacturers might require tighter process control, traceability, unique materials, and higher-reliability finish options like ENEPIG or ENIG surface finish pcb.
